^^ Indeed the details are stunning, noise reduction is almost perfect, but i notice one big problem: traces of some edge oversharpening (no, don't associate this things with N-R) or oversaturation of reds whatever it is(just look at the overcooked reds on the car and the one at the top of the building) just take note that we can't compare the samples from gsmarena to the samples of satio as well. the daylight is prevalent on pixon while on the satio it is obvious that it isn't (especially the leave-less trees on satio). which gives us an idea of what was the daylight conditions on both scenes when each of them where captured.
